#announce(options = nil) ⇒ Object
Make a release announcement. Generates and can email release announcements. The announcement if built from the README file unless another file is specified.
This will subsititue the first line mathing /please see notes/i for the notelog. And /please see change/i for the changelog.
The following settings apply:
title Project title.
subtitle Brief one-line description.
version Project version.
description Long description of project.
homepage Project homepage web address.
slogan Motto for you project.
memo File that contains announcement message.
template Announcement template file, rather then README.
mail_to Email address(es) to send announcemnt.
If mail_to is set then these also apply:
from Message FROM address [email].
subject Subject of email message ([ANN] title verison).
server Email server to route message.
port Email server's port.
domain Email server's domain name.
account Email account name [email].
login Login type: plain, cram_md5 or login.
secure Uses TLS security, true or false?
A template file can be specified that uses “$setting” as substitutes for poject information.

#clean(options = nil) ⇒ Object
Clean scrap products. All directory paths and or file globs listed under the clean configuration entry, can be removed via this method. By default all files ending with “~” or .back are removed. To specifcy an alternate provide a list of files and/or glibs under remove:
sub-entry. You can also provide an exclude:
sub-entry to isolate files not to be removed. For example, on might do:
clean:
remove [ '**/*~', '**/*.bak', '.config' ]
Clean is run as a prerequiste to #release via #prepare.

#log_notes(options = {}) ⇒ Object
Collect embedded notes.
This task scans source code for developer notes and writes to well organized files. This tool can lookup and list TODO, FIXME and other types of labeled comments from source code.
files Glob(s) of files to search.
labels Labels to search for. Defaults to [ 'TODO', 'FIXME' ].
output Output directory. Defaults to log/.

#test_cross(options = nil) ⇒ Object
Run cross comparison testing.
This tool runs unit tests in pairs to make sure there is cross library compatibility. Each pari is run in a separate interpretor to prevent script clash. This makes for a more robust test facility and prevents potential conflicts between test scripts.
tests Test files (eg. test/tc_**/*.rb) [test/**/*]
loadpath Directories to include in load path.
require List of files to require prior to running tests.
live Deactive use of local libs and test against install.
